CRH completes Trident sale to GCC

Print this page

US: CRH has completed the sale of cement and ready-mix assets to Grupo Cementos de Chihuahua (GCC) following its acquisition of Ash Grove Cement. Ireland's biggest company sold the Trident cement plant in Montana to GCC for US$107.5m.

The move comes less than a month after CRH received regulatory approval from the US Federal Trade Commission to acquire cement manufacturer Ash Grove Cement for US$3.5bn in a deal first announced in September 2017.

As part of the transaction with GCC, CRH acquired most of the ready-mix plants and transportation assets belonging to GCC in Oklahoma and northwest Arkansas for US$118.5m. GCC will continue to own and operate four ready-mix plants in the Fort Smith, Arkansas area and own an office building in Tulsa, Oklahoma, which it will lease to CRH.
The purchase and sale amounts have been paid in full but are subject to final inventory valuation adjustments, which are expected to be completed within 90 days.
